CCTV footage of a missing woman who was last seen leaving her home in an historic market town has been released by police.
Mavis, 62, has been reported missing from her Darlington home in North Yorkshire, since around 12.30 pm on Tuesday, September 16.


A spokesperson for Durham Police said: “Mavis is believed to have been heading in the direction of Darlington town centre, and officers have now released CCTV images which show her leave South Park, opposite the entrance to Heslop Drive, just after 1.30pm.
The 62-year-old has been described as 6ft tall, with long blonde hair, and was carrying a black leather and bag.
Durham Police added: “Officers would particularly like to hear from anyone with CCTV or dashcam footage covering the Skerne Park and West End areas of Darlington around that time.
“Additionally, the farming community is asked to check their farmland and outbuildings.
“Anybody with any information relating to her whereabouts is asked to call 101.”
